Side-by-Side Nutrition Facts

Nutrient Donut Pineapple Better
Calories 421kcal 50kcal Pineapple
Protein 4.9g 0.5g Donut
Total Fat 22.6g 0.1g Pineapple
Carbohydrates 51.5g 13.1g Donut
Fiber 0.7g 1.4g Pineapple
Sugar 25.6g 9.9g Pineapple
Vitamin C 0mg 47.8mg Pineapple
Calcium 28mg 13mg Donut
Iron 1.7mg 0.3mg Donut
Potassium 65mg 109mg Pineapple

Donut vs Pineapple — Key Takeaway

Pineapple has 371 fewer calories per 100g than Donut, making it the lighter option. For protein, Donut leads with 4.9g per 100g. Pineapple provides 47.8mg of vitamin C.
